Cyber Security Engineer: Job Description, Skills, Salary & Career Guide 2025
The role of a Cyber Security Engineer has become one of the most in-demand and high-growth careers in 2025. Organizations worldwide are increasingly investing in skilled professionals who can protect digital assets, secure networks, and defend systems from cyberattacks. This article offers a complete breakdown of the profession, roles, responsibilities, required skills, job opportunities, salaries, certifications, and growth prospects—while integrating the keyword Cyber Security Engineer 200 times throughout the content.
Who Is a Cyber Security Engineer?
A Cyber Security Engineer is a security professional responsible for designing, implementing, managing, and monitoring security solutions that protect an organization’s digital infrastructure. A Cyber Security Engineer focuses on preventing cyber threats, identifying vulnerabilities, analyzing risks, and applying advanced security controls.
In simple words, a Cyber Security Engineer ensures that your company’s systems, networks, apps, and data stay safe from hackers, malware, ransomware, phishing, data breaches, and internal misuse.
A Cyber Security Engineer is also involved in building secure architecture, integrating security tools, monitoring suspicious activity, and responding to security incidents.
Today, every sector—from banking to e-commerce to government—hires a Cyber Security Engineer to strengthen their digital defense systems.
Cyber Security Engineer Job Description
The official job description of a Cyber Security Engineer includes developing robust security frameworks, preventing attacks, protecting sensitive data, and ensuring that all digital platforms operate safely.
A typical Cyber Security Engineer job description includes:
- Designing and implementing secure network solutions
- Running vulnerability tests and penetration assessments
- Monitoring the organization’s security infrastructure
- Ensuring compliance with industry regulations
- Managing firewalls, IDS/IPS, SIEM tools, and EDR platforms
- Responding to cyber incidents and eliminating threats
- Securing cloud environments (AWS, Azure, GCP)
Organizations expect a Cyber Security Engineer to be technically strong, analytical, and updated with the latest attack patterns.
Roles and Responsibilities of a Cyber Security Engineer
A Cyber Security Engineer performs multiple high-level responsibilities to safeguard enterprise systems. Common tasks include:
1. Security Architecture Development
A Cyber Security Engineer builds secure network architecture and creates strong defense layers.
2. Vulnerability Management
The Cyber Security Engineer continuously checks for vulnerabilities, misconfigurations, outdated software, and patch gaps.
3. Threat Detection & Response
A Cyber Security Engineer monitors logs, detects suspicious activities, analyzes alerts, and responds to threats before damage occurs.
4. Firewall & Network Protection
Configuring and maintaining firewalls, VPNs, proxy services, and network security tools remain core tasks of a Cyber Security Engineer.
5. Incident Handling
When a breach occurs, a Cyber Security Engineer performs forensic analysis, finds root causes, and ensures systems recover safely.
6. Automation & Scripting
A modern Cyber Security Engineer uses Python, Bash, or PowerShell to automate routine security tasks.
7. Cloud Security
Securing AWS, Azure, or Google Cloud environments is now essential for a Cyber Security Engineer.
8. Compliance & Policy Creation
A Cyber Security Engineer ensures compliance with standards like ISO 27001, NIST, PCI DSS, and GDPR.
9. Collaboration with IT & DevOps Teams
A Cyber Security Engineer works with multiple teams to ensure security at every stage of development.
In short, every responsibility of a Cyber Security Engineer directly contributes to protecting an organization from cyber risks.
Skills Required for Cyber Security Engineers
To succeed as a Cyber Security Engineer, you need a combination of technical, analytical, and problem-solving skills.
Technical Skills
- Network Security Skills (firewalls, routing, switching)
- Knowledge of Linux, Windows & Cloud Systems
- SIEM tools (Splunk, QRadar, ELK)
- IDS/IPS tools
- Ethical hacking & penetration testing
- Cryptography
- Risk assessment
- Scripting languages (Python, Bash, PowerShell)
- Cloud security principles
- Vulnerability scanning tools (Nessus, Qualys)
Soft Skills
- Analytical thinking
- Problem-solving attitude
- Communication abilities
- Decision-making
- Team collaboration
- Documentation and reporting
A strong Cyber Security Engineer must also stay updated with new threats, zero-day attacks, and cybersecurity trends.
Job Outlook for Cyber Security Engineers with Salary Details
The demand for Cyber Security Engineer roles is projected to grow by 35% globally through 2030, making it one of the fastest-growing IT careers.
Here are average salary ranges in top countries:
United States
A Cyber Security Engineer earns $95,000 – $165,000/year.
India
A Cyber Security Engineer earns ₹6,00,000 – ₹22,00,000/year depending on skills and certifications.
United Kingdom
A Cyber Security Engineer earns £45,000 – £90,000/year.
Canada
A Cyber Security Engineer earns CAD 70,000 – CAD 130,000/year.
UAE
A Cyber Security Engineer earns AED 180,000 – AED 360,000/year.
Australia
A Cyber Security Engineer earns AUD 95,000 – AUD 160,000/year.
Because of global cyber threats, organizations now hire more Cyber Security Engineer professionals than ever before.
Largest Recruiters in Different Countries
A Cyber Security Engineer can work in any industry. The biggest employers include:
United States
- Amazon
- Microsoft
- IBM
- Meta
- Cisco
India
- TCS
- Infosys
- Wipro
- HCL
- Accenture
- Deloitte
UK
- BT Group
- Barclays
- HSBC
- EY
- BAE Systems
UAE
- Emirates Group
- Etisalat
- ADNOC
- Dubai Police
Canada & Australia
- RBC
- TD Bank
- Telstra
- Commonwealth Bank
All these companies regularly hire Cyber Security Engineer professionals.
Who Can Become a Cyber Security Engineer?
Anyone with passion for cybersecurity can become a Cyber Security Engineer.
Ideal backgrounds include:
- Computer science
- IT or Information security
- Networking
- Cloud computing
- Software development
- Ethical hacking
Even non-IT professionals can become a Cyber Security Engineer through proper training and certifications.
Qualities of a good Cyber Security Engineer include curiosity, attention to detail, and a love for solving complex security problems.
Top Cyber Security Engineer Certifications for Upskilling
Certifications help you become a strong and employable Cyber Security Engineer.
Best Certifications:
- CEH (Certified Ethical Hacker)
- CompTIA Security+
- CompTIA CySA+
- CISSP
- CISM
- CCSP (Cloud Security)
- OSCP
- Certified SOC Analyst
- AWS & Azure Security Certifications
These certifications enhance your profile as a Cyber Security Engineer and increase your earning potential.
Conclusion
The role of a Cyber Security Engineer is more important today than ever. As organizations shift to digital platforms, the need for a skilled Cyber Security Engineer who can detect threats, secure networks, and protect sensitive data continues to rise. With the right skills, certifications, and dedication, anyone can build a successful career as a Cyber Security Engineer in 2025 and beyond.
This detailed guide has explained the full job description, responsibilities, required skills, salary insights, recruiters, and career opportunities. Becoming a Cyber Security Engineer is not only rewarding but also essential in the modern cyber world.